The trade-offs

Strengths and Limitations

Bland AI

Strengths

  • One per-minute rate covers the language model, speech-to-text, text-to-speech and telephony, with no token charges or provider pass-throughs
  • Self-hosted and on-premises deployments, plus US, EU and APAC data residency
  • SOC 2 Type II, HIPAA, GDPR and PCI DSS v4.0, with FedRAMP 20X Class A available
  • The same pathways, personas and memory run across voice, SMS, RCS, iMessage and web chat

Limitations

  • Owning the stack means no choice of speech or language model provider
  • The lower $0.12 per minute rate carries a $299 / month platform fee, so it only pays off above a certain volume
  • Transfer time to a human is billed on top of the per-minute rate
  • Positioned around regulated enterprise workloads, which is more platform than a small team needs for a single use case

Typecast

Strengths

  • 700+ voices with fine emotion and delivery control
  • Context-aware emotion model adapts tone to the script
  • Affordable entry with a commercial license from $5 per month

Limitations

  • Free tier is limited to trial voices and requires attribution
  • Credit allowances are modest on the lower tiers

Plans

Pricing

Bland AI

  • Start $0.14 Per minute, with no platform fee. Includes 2 credits and an inbound number, valued by the vendor at $15 / month, and needs no card. Transfer time is $0.05 per minute.
  • Build $0.12 Per minute plus a $299 / month platform fee. Transfer time is $0.04 per minute.
  • Enterprise Not stated Contact sales. Contracted to your volume and includes dedicated infrastructure, version-controlled releases and canary deployments.

Typecast

  • Free $0 3,000 lifetime credits (around 5 minutes), trial voices only, attribution required.
  • Basic $5 / month $54 / year. 30,000 credits per month (around 35 minutes), all AI voices, commercial license, 1 instant cloning slot.
  • Plus $19 / month $204 / year. 40,000 credits per month, speed control, 1 professional cloning slot.
  • Pro $29 / month $312 / year. 75,000 credits per month, emotion and intonation controls, 2 cloning slots.
  • Business $69 / month $744 / year. 200,000 credits per month, 10 cloning slots, additional credit purchases.
  • Enterprise Not stated Custom pricing.
